Travelers United Inc., the traveler advocacy group, is taking Hilton Worldwide Holdings Inc. and Hilton Domestic Operating Co. Inc. to court. Why? They’re claiming Hilton is playing a little fast and loose with room rates by tacking on last-minute fees, the so-called “junk fees.” These include things like “resort fees” and “destination fees.” Where’s this showdown happening? The class action lawsuit has made its way to a federal court in the District of Columbia.

Who Is Eligible For The Hilton hidden Hotel Fees Class Lawsuit

Travelers United is calling foul on Hilton, claiming they’re playing a sneaky game with what they call “junk fees.” According to them, Hilton doesn’t lay out these fees in the upfront cost of hotel rooms, making it seem like the rooms are cheaper than they really are. That, according to the lawsuit, goes against the District of Columbia Consumer Protection Procedures Act. They’re arguing that Hilton’s tricks violate everyone’s right to truthful info about the real deal behind those nightly room rates.

Travelers United is stepping up to represent a whole crew of consumers across the nation. Who’s in the club? Anyone who got a Hilton hotel room within the District of Columbia for personal use and had to cough up one of those tricky fees – the resort, destination, or other similar fees to Hilton.
